Q: Will the Senior Concerns Love Run take place this year?

A: Yes. The 19th Annual Love Run is scheduled for June 3. Registration and start of activities will be at 2815 Townsgate Road in Thousand Oaks.

Registration is at 6:30 a.m. The 10-kilometer run is scheduled for 7:45 a.m., the 5K for 8 a.m. and the one-mile fun run and Betty Berry Brigade for 9:15 a.m.

The 5K and 10K are on a USA Track & Field-certified chip-timed out and back flat course around Westlake Lake. Final times will be provided, and awards will be given to the top three male and three female finishers in all age groups. Children younger than 11 who participate in the fun run will get medals.

Early registration is $35, and registration June 3 is $40. Fees include bib numbers, timing, medals, T-shirts for the first 1,500 entrants and a post-race party and refreshments.

The Love Run is a major fundraiser for Senior Concerns’ Meals-on-Wheels program. All proceeds go toward providing meals to homebound elderly people who cannot shop or prepare meals for themselves.
